SetPlugInstate(Webettings.pluginstate)已弃用.我应该怎么办?(WebView插件)



我将闪存游戏带入具有以下代码的Android应用程序。它可以正常工作,但是编译器给出了错误

类型 Webettings已弃用

这是代码。

webview.getSettings().setJavaScriptEnabled(true);
webview.getSettings().setPluginState(PluginState.ON);
webview.loadUrl("file:///android_asset/myflashgame.swf");

此代码有效,但不长。我如何实现相同的效果?我读到将来将不支持WebView插件。有其他方法可以制作我的Flash游戏吗?

我听说过Adobe Air。仍然支持吗?将来仍然有效吗?

是的,您应该使用空气将游戏编译为Android应用程序。仅使用SDK可行。Google以获取示例,如果SDK提供的示例还不够。

如果您刚刚启动,则可以通过选择 new >> ActionScript移动项目并选择Android作为目标来直接从Flash Builder构建应用程序可能更容易。

相关内容

  • 没有找到相关文章

最新更新